Adapting to Changing Traditions

त्यौहार मनाने का तरीका बदलता है, भावना वही रहती है।

Pronunciation: Tyauhaar manaane ka tareeka badalta hai, bhavna wahi rehti hai.

Meaning: The way of celebrating festivals changes, but the emotion remains the same.

Reflection

As children grow up and possibly move away, the way we celebrate festivals as a family may change significantly. This can be challenging for parents who hold fond memories of bustling homes filled with traditional activities. However, at the heart of any celebration is not the rituals but the emotion they carry. It's essential to recognize that the love and joy shared during these times can remain constant, even if the manner of expression evolves.

Acknowledging this change can reduce the emotional friction often created by expectations tied to past traditions. Parents can embrace new ways to celebrate that may incorporate digital gatherings or even joining new family traditions with the children's spouses. By focusing on the emotional connection rather than the method, parents and children can find joy and warmth in every form of celebration.

Practical Application

In the upcoming week, explore a new way to celebrate an approaching festival, perhaps by setting up a virtual call for distant family members or trying a new, inclusive tradition at home. Embrace suggestions from your children or their families to co-create a meaningful and joyful festival experience.
